Abstract

We propose a method for path selection using pre-computation in an ATM network. The method is based on an algorithm that pre-computes a list of routes for each node in the network. We then study the lack of diversity in the paths chosen by our method, and the resulting risk of call blocking. Improvements to the method are proposed, and the decrease in call blocking is evaluated by simulation. We show that, with a load-balancing assumption, the method is able to provide paths equivalent to those of the On-Demand method.
